Guys and gals if you relocate your license plate or are thinking of doing it but worried about the hole to fill. The "Jeep JK OEM License Plate Hole Cover" PN 55397112AA is available at moparsupercenter dot com. Not sure what the dealer is charging for it but i got mine for no more than $15 shipped!!!
